华为云国际站充值:java mysql数据库密码加密

华为云国际站充值:Java MySQL数据库密码加密实践指南

引言

在当今数字化时代,数据安全已成为企业发展的重中之重。作为全球领先的云计算服务提供商,华为云凭借其强大的技术实力和丰富的产品矩阵,为企业用户提供安全可靠的云服务解决方案。本文将重点探讨如何在华为云国际站环境下,使用Java对MySQL数据库密码进行加密处理,并结合华为云服务器的优势,为开发者提供一套完整的安全实践方案。

华为云的核心优势

1. 全球化的基础设施布局

华为云在全球范围内建立了广泛的数据中心网络,覆盖亚太、欧洲、拉丁美洲等多个区域,为用户提供低延迟、高可用的云服务体验。

2. 完善的安全合规体系

华为云通过ISO 27001、CSA STAR等多项国际安全认证,提供从物理安全到应用安全的端到端防护,满足不同地区的合规要求。

3. 强大的数据库服务

华为云RDS for MySQL提供自动备份、故障自动切换等高可用功能,并支持透明数据加密(TDE),为数据安全提供多层级保护。

4. 灵活的计费方式

华为云国际站支持多种充值方式和计费模式,包括按需付费和包年包月,满足不同规模企业的成本控制需求。

Java实现MySQL密码加密方案

1. 加密算法选择

推荐使用AES-256或RSA等强加密算法。华为云的密钥管理服务(KMS)可以安全地存储和管理加密密钥。

// AES加密示例
Cipher cipher = Cipher.getInstance("AES/CBC/PKCS5Padding");
cipher.init(Cipher.ENCRYPT_MODE, secretKey);
byte[] encryptedPassword = cipher.doFinal(password.getBytes());

2. 密码存储策略

建议采用加盐哈希(Salted Hash)方式存储密码,可以有效防御彩虹表攻击。

3. 连接池配置

在使用连接池(如HikariCP)时,可以通过DataSource的password属性注入解密后的密码:

HikariConfig config = new HikariConfig();
config.setPassword(decrypt(encryptedPassword));

4. 华为云最佳实践

结合华为云数据库安全组和VPC隔离,确保只有授权的应用服务器能够访问数据库。

华为云产品集成方案

1. 弹性云服务器(ECS)

华为云ECS提供高性能计算资源,支持一键部署Java运行环境,是运行加密应用的理想平台。

华为云国际站充值:java mysql数据库密码加密

2. 关系型数据库(RDS)

华为云RDS for MySQL支持SSL加密连接,与应用程序的加密方案形成纵深防御。

3. 数据加密服务(DEW)

华为云数据加密服务提供密钥的全生命周期管理,可用于保护数据库连接密码等敏感信息。

4. 安全运营中心(SOC)

实时监控数据库访问行为,及时发现异常操作,为加密系统提供额外安全保障。

实施步骤指南

  1. 在华为云国际站完成账户注册和充值
  2. 创建VPC网络和安全组规则
  3. 部署ECS实例并安装Java环境
  4. 配置RDS MySQL实例,启用SSL连接
  5. 在应用中实现密码加密逻辑
  6. 使用华为云KMS管理加密密钥
  7. 通过SOC服务持续监控系统安全

本章总结

本文详细介绍了在华为云国际站环境下,使用Java实现MySQL数据库密码加密的完整方案。华为云凭借其全球化基础设施、严格的安全合规标准和丰富的产品服务,为企业数据安全提供了坚实保障。通过弹性云服务器、关系型数据库、数据加密服务等产品的有机结合,开发者可以构建起从密码加密到访问控制的多层次安全防护体系。建议企业在实际应用中,根据业务需求选择合适的华为云产品组合,并定期评估和更新安全策略,以应对不断演变的网络安全威胁。

华为云不仅提供技术领先的云计算资源,更通过一站式的安全解决方案,让企业能够专注于业务创新,而无须过度担忧基础架构的安全问题。这种”安全即服务”的理念,正是华为云区别于其他云服务提供商的核心竞争力所在。

发布者:luotuoemo,转转请注明出处:https://www.jintuiyun.com/441627.html

(0)
luotuoemo的头像luotuoemo
上一篇 2026年1月10日 14:09
下一篇 2026年1月10日 14:11

相关推荐

  • 宁波华为云代理商:安卓 sdk ocr

    一、概述 近年来,随着移动互联网的快速发展,手机上的应用也越来越丰富,其中智能识别功能尤为突出。而这些智能识别功能,离不开OCR(Optical Character Recognition)即光学字符识别技术的支持。然而,要实现高效、准确的OCR功能,就需要强大的云服务平台。华为云作为全球领先的云服务提供商,便提供了这样一种解决方案。宁波华为云代理商将为您详…

    2024年3月17日
    63200
  • 华为云国际站代理商注册:cdn静态页面跨域

    华为云国际站代理商注册:CDN静态页面跨域问题解析 在现代的互联网应用中,CDN(内容分发网络)已经成为加速静态资源加载、提升网站用户体验的重要技术之一。对于华为云国际站代理商来说,使用华为云的CDN服务不仅能优化静态页面的加载速度,还可以避免许多跨域问题。然而,跨域问题是开发者在使用CDN时常遇到的一个难题。本文将从华为云CDN的优势出发,深入探讨如何通过…

    2024年12月12日
    54800
  • 华为云国际站代理商充值:cdn域名怎么查询

    华为云国际站代理商充值:CDN域名查询操作指南 随着全球互联网业务的不断扩展,企业对于内容分发网络(CDN)的需求愈加迫切。CDN技术通过在全球范围内部署节点,将用户请求的数据缓存至最近的服务器,从而提高网站和应用的访问速度和稳定性。华为云作为领先的云计算服务提供商,提供了高效、安全的CDN服务,而在使用华为云CDN时,代理商充值和域名查询是非常重要的操作环…

    2024年12月7日
    45900
  • 华为云国际站代理商充值:ftp服务器如何登录服务器地址

    华为云国际站代理商充值:FTP服务器如何登录服务器地址 随着云计算的快速发展,越来越多的企业和开发者选择使用云服务器来部署和管理他们的应用。作为全球领先的云计算服务商,华为云提供了高效、稳定且安全的云基础设施,广泛应用于各类企业的数字化转型。本文将重点介绍华为云国际站代理商充值的相关操作,特别是FTP服务器如何登录服务器地址,并结合华为云服务器的优势进行讲解…

    2025年3月25日
    48900
  • 华为云国际站注册:互联网数据库设计 存类型

    华为云国际站注册:互联网数据库设计存储类型解析 引言:数据库设计的核心挑战 在数字化时代,互联网应用的数据规模呈指数级增长,数据库设计与存储方案的选择直接关系到系统的性能、可靠性和成本效率。华为云国际站为企业提供了全面的数据库服务组合,针对不同业务场景提供最优存储类型解决方案。本文将深入探讨如何基于华为云优势进行互联网数据库设计中的存储类型选择。 一、华为云…

    2026年1月3日
    27100

联系我们

4000-747-360

在线咨询: QQ交谈

邮件:ixuntao@qq.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信
购买阿里云服务器请访问:https://www.4526.cn/